Ticket: Staging env misconfigured for Siftgate bloom filter

The bloom layer in front of the Pellet KV store is rejecting all lookups in staging because the env file was copied from the dev template without credentials. False-positive tuning values are fine; only the auth line is missing. To unblock the weekly demo, the Pellet admission secret must be set on the following line.

env line for yaguf-fajop: LEDGER_TOKEN13=fb08984397349

**CI note: Queuewright autoscaler stuck at floor**

If the Queuewright autoscaler won't scale past its floor during CI soak runs, check whether the depth metric is reporting zero — the mock broker resets counters between stages, which starves the scaler of signal. Quick fix: re-enable the metric bridge in the soak config and rerun. Grab the failing run's trace token below for comparison.

pipeline stamp: htk31_f769b577b3028a4e9958e5bb8d1259a

14:20 — Migration of scheduled tasks from legacy cron to the Tallowfen workflow engine completed for core jobs, but plugin-registered schedules were not carried over because the Bramblewick shim only scanned the primary crontab. Plugin authors saw silent skips for roughly 90 minutes. We restored the shim, replayed missed triggers in order, and verified idempotency guards held. The trace token for the replay run is listed below.

pipeline stamp: htk21_86b657ac0aa916a9af17f

## Runbook: account recovery — DateSmith locale service

When a customer of DateSmith gets locked out mid-migration (usually after flipping their org from DD/MM to MM/DD and panicking), support can restore access via the recovery console. Verify identity first — two account facts minimum, no exceptions. Then open the console, pick the org, and hit "restore admin." It'll prompt for the team recovery passphrase, which rotates quarterly. The current one is right below.

vault phrase of hahop-badug = novvan-ulaion-zorius-noviel-gorwyn-casix-tamys